What is Tennis Elbow

Tennis elbow, also known as lateral epicondylitis, is an overuse and muscle strain injury that results in an inflammation of the outside of the elbow and forearm areas. With repeated use, those muscles become overworked and eventually become inflamed.

Tennis elbow is usually caused by overusing the muscles attached to the elbow that are used to straighten your wrist. If the muscles are strained, tiny tears and inflammation can develop on the outside of you elbow.

Symptoms Of Tennis Elbow

  • Pain on the outside of the elbow.
  • Pain while lifting or bending your arm.
  • Pain while gripping small objects.
  • Pain while twisting your forearm.

What Is Golfers Elbow

Golfers elbow, also known as medial epicondylitis, is an irritation on the inner side of the arm and elbow. It is a condition that causes pain where the tendons of your forearm muscles attach to the bony bump on the inside of your elbow.

Golfers elbow is commonly caused by damage to the muscles and tendons that control your wrist and fingers. The damage is typically related to excess or repeated stress on the muscles.

Symptoms Of Golfers Elbow

  • Pain on the inner side of your elbow
  • Elbow stiffness
  • Weakness in hands or wrists
  • Numbness or tingling in fingers.
